5 Essential Winter Car Maintenance Checks

As winter approaches, ensuring your vehicle is prepared for the colder months is vital. Cold weather can be harsh on your car, so performing essential maintenance checks can save you from future headaches. Here are five key maintenance checks you should carry out:

1. Battery Health Check

Cold weather can be tough on your car’s battery. The lower temperatures can reduce the battery's ability to hold a charge, leading to starting issues.

What to Do: Have your battery tested to ensure it has enough charge. Look for signs of corrosion on the terminals and ensure the connections are tight and clean. If your battery is over three years old, consider getting it tested by a professional.

2. Tire Inspection and Rotation

Tires are crucial for safe driving, especially in winter when roads can be slippery.

What to Do: Check your tire tread depth – the minimum recommended depth is 3/32 inches. Consider winter tires if you live in an area with heavy snowfall. Also, check your tire pressure regularly, as it tends to drop in colder temperatures.

3. Antifreeze and Coolant Level

Antifreeze (or coolant) is essential to keep your engine from freezing in cold temperatures.

What to Do: Ensure the coolant is at the correct level and concentration. A 50/50 mix of coolant and water is typically recommended. You can use an antifreeze tester to check the mixture's strength.

4. Windshield Wipers and Fluid

Good visibility is essential, and winter conditions can challenge it.

What to Do: Replace any worn or damaged wiper blades. Ensure your windshield washer fluid is full and use a winter-specific fluid that won’t freeze.

5. Lights and Electrical Systems

Shorter days mean you’ll be using your lights more frequently.

What to Do: Check all your lights – headlights, tail lights, brake lights, and indicators – to ensure they are working correctly. Clean them regularly to ensure maximum visibility.

Conclusion

Winter can be a challenging time for drivers and their vehicles. Performing these essential maintenance checks can help ensure your safety and reduce the risk of breakdowns. Remember, if you’re not comfortable performing any of these checks yourself, it’s always a good idea to seek help from a professional mechanic. Engine failure is a car owner's nightmare, yet it's often preventable with some know-how and routine care. Here’s a condensed guide to keep your engine purring and your wallet happy:

🛠 Regular Maintenance Checks:
Don't wait for the "check engine" light. Routine checks are like health check-ups for your car. Keep an eye on fluid levels, belts, and hoses, and never ignore odd noises or smells.

🔄 Oil Changes:
Oil is your engine’s lifeblood. Regular changes prevent buildup that can clog and wear out your engine faster. Plus, it’s a chance for a mechanic to spot issues before they worsen.

🌡 Watch the Temperature:
Overheating is a major red flag. Ensure your cooling system is flush with coolant, the radiator is in good shape, and the thermostat works correctly to prevent a meltdown.

🔗 Belt & Chain Vigilance:
Timing belts and chains are the unsung heroes of engine timing and function. If these snap, they can cause catastrophic damage. Replace them according to your car's service schedule.

💨 Air Filter Replacement:
Breathing clean air is as important for your car as it is for you. A clogged air filter can reduce efficiency and lead to increased engine wear. Check and replace it regularly.

⚡ Spark Plug Maintenance:
Faulty spark plugs can decrease your engine's efficiency or even stop it from running. They're easy to check and cheap to replace, so make it a part of your regular maintenance.

🔧 Use Quality Parts:
When replacing any parts, choose quality over economy. Substandard parts can fail quickly and cause more harm than good.

📖 Understand Your Car:
Know what's normal for your vehicle. Read the manual to understand the service intervals and stick to them.

🔍 Early Detection:
Pay attention to the warning signs. Power loss, strange noises, smoke, or even a sudden change in fuel efficiency can signal problems.

🚗 Drive Responsibly:
Hard accelerations and braking, high-speed driving, and not warming up the engine can all contribute to wear and tear.

Preventing engine failure doesn't just prolong your car's life; it also maintains its value and ensures your safety on the road. Keep these tips in mind, and you're less likely to face unexpected engine trouble. Drive smart, maintain regularly, and listen to your car—it's always communicating with you!
